Coast Guard rescues senior citizen, three fishermen off Basilan

The Philippine Coast Guard (PCG) reported on Saturday, July 11, 2026, the successful rescue of a senior citizen from Zamboanga City and three fishermen from Sulu in separate incidents off Basilan province and in the Celebes Sea.

Rescue of Senior Citizen off Basilan

Sayyari Buhari, 61, was rescued by personnel of the Coast Guard Station (CGS)-Isabela around 12:40 a.m. on Friday, July 10, in the waters near Tabiawan village, Isabela City, the capital of Basilan province. The rescue operation was launched after Basiriya Bukang reported that her father, Buhari, had gone missing while traveling between Zamboanga City and Isabela City on a motorized banca. Bukang stated that they lost communication with Buhari at approximately 11:30 p.m. on Thursday, July 9.

According to the CGS-Isabela, an investigation revealed that Buhari's motorized banca sustained hull damage after encountering strong waves during the crossing. The coast guard team safely towed the banca to James Walter Strong Boulevard in Seaside village, Isabela City. The CGS-Isabela noted, “He (Buhari) was found to be in good physical condition and did not require further medical assistance.”

Rescue of Three Fishermen in Celebes Sea

In a separate incident, three fishermen from Siasi, Sulu—Tuyo Alahari, 50; Marsol Alahari, 20; and Boni Alahari, 13—were rescued in the Celebes Sea on Monday, July 6. The PCG reported that the fishermen were found near their sunken motorized banca by the crew of TS 2012 Alpha, a fish carrier vessel operated by Seagull Fishing Venture. The rescue occurred while the vessel was sailing in the Celebes Sea.

The three rescued fishermen were safely transported to General Santos City aboard the fish carrier vessel, accompanied by personnel of the PCG Auxiliary (PCGA) Executive Squadron. Personnel from the Coast Guard District Southern Mindanao (CGDSM) facilitated their transport from Spring Valley Compound in Tumbler village, General Santos City, and turned them over to CGS-Zamboanga del Sur on Wednesday, July 8, for proper turnover and assistance.

Assistance and Return to Home Province

The PCG stated that before their return journey to Siasi, Sulu, CGS-Zamboanga del Sur extended assistance to the three rescued fishermen by facilitating their safe transport to Zamboanga City and ensuring their welfare and necessary support. The PCG recognized the immediate assistance provided by TS 2012 Alpha and its crew for their vital role in ensuring the safety and survival of the three fishermen.
